Job Description

  • During your thesis, you will perform optical and FEM simulations to calculate the transmission of light through silicon wafers.
  • Based on the simulation results you will develop an optical wafer inspection strategy.
  • You will compare the simulation results with measurements on laser-treated wafers and identify relevant correlations.
  • Furthermore, you will collaborate on the setup of a new imaging stage for micrometer-level stress measurement in depth and on the surface.
  • The experimental correlation with other stress measurement strategies to characterize the optical measurement device also falls within your area of responsibility.
